Pricing and Value: Is It Worth It?

Fly from Nairobi to Maasai Mara:Full-Day Game Drive & Return - Pricing and Value: Is It Worth It?

At $1,200 per person, this tour offers a comprehensive, all-in-one wildlife experience. The cost includes round-trip flights, guided game drives, and lunches, which many travelers consider a good deal given the convenience and expert guidance.

The main additional expense is the park fee — USD 100 from January to June, rising to USD 200 later in the year. While this is an extra, it’s a standard expense for safaris in Kenya and can be paid on arrival. For many, the value lies in the seamless logistics, expert guides, and the chance to see iconic animals in a single day.

The reviews frequently mention how much more valuable this experience feels compared to DIY options, which might involve long drives or complicated arrangements. The guided expertise and aerial views add an element of richness that’s hard to match in self-drive safaris.

FAQ

Fly from Nairobi to Maasai Mara:Full-Day Game Drive & Return - FAQ

What is included in the tour?
The tour covers round-trip flights from Nairobi to Maasai Mara, guided game drives in a 4×4 vehicle, delicious packed lunches, and hotel pick-up and drop-off.

Are park fees included?
No, park fees are paid separately upon arrival — USD 100 from January to June, and USD 200 from July to December.

How long is the flight?
The flight from Nairobi to Maasai Mara is short, typically around 45 minutes, offering quick transit and more time for wildlife viewing.

What should I bring?
Bring your passport, camera, binoculars, neutral-colored clothing, and sun protection, as well as any personal essentials.

Is this suitable for children or elderly travelers?
The tour involves a short flight and full-day game drives, so it’s best suited for travelers who are comfortable with these activities. Check with the provider for specific age restrictions.

Can I cancel or change my booking?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und. Booking is flexible, with the option to reserve now and pay later.
